Hazelnuts: INC sparks controversy

May 26, 2023 at 10:57 AM , Der AUDITOR
Play report as audio

ORDU. While Turkey is still in a mode of suspension, controversy has broken loose over the production estimates for hazelnuts in Spain presented at the Nut and Dried Fruit Council Congress in London.

Far cry from reality

Trouble is that the INC issued an impossibly low production estimate of 2,500 mt citing the Association and Federation of Agricultural Cooperatives of Catalonia as a source. Yet, the Spanish Almond Board Almendrave, the Association of Almond and Hazelnut Exporters of Spain, has issued a clarification that not only states that the Catalonian association does not provide any production estimates but also that a figure of 25,000 mt is more realistic as many young trees are bearing fruit and flowering was very promising.
